    The fact of the matter is that the bureacrats and politicians who were in charge of oragnising the CW games made a fortune. Its difficult to beleive that these are the most expensive commonwealth games ever considering the amount of cheap labour we have. Dirt cheap I should say...

    When toilet rolls are purchased for $89 per pack, then there is surely something amiss. The bridge that collapsed recently...I am almost sure that the corrupt officials took underhand money from the private construction company which built that bridge..and its pretty obvious that low quality design and materials were used. The firm had actually been blacklisted by the Delhi Metro Rail Corporation last year...this stinks so bad that I often wish that the games get cancelled so that there is enough public anger to get these corrupt politicians and officials punished.
